Coolant Outlet Connector: Removal
W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2021 Ford F-150.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
- Remove the direct injection fuel rail LH. Refer to: Direct Injection Fuel Rail LH .
- Remove the direct injection fuel rail RH. Refer to: Direct Injection Fuel Rail RH .
- Remove the coolant pump. Refer to: Coolant Pump .
- Remove the knock sensor harness retainer from the fastener stud.
- Release the clamps and disconnect the coolant hoses. Remove the fasteners and the coolant outlet connector and inlet pipe assembly.

NOTE: This step is only necessary when installing a new component.
Separate the coolant inlet pipe from the coolant outlet connector. Inspect the grommet and replace if necessary.
- Inspect the coolant outlet connector O-ring and replace if necessary.
